A Carter Lumber Assistant Maintenance Specialist is responsible for working alongside our Maintenance team to maintain a clean, functional facility while also performing daily repairs, emergency and preventative maintenance. Inspects all machinery to ensure safety functions are working properly. A strong belief in the mission and goals of the company are necessary to this position.  

Requirements:

  • Previous maintenance and electrical experience 

  • Knowledge and expertise in machinery maintenance

  • Strong organizational skills and excellent communication skills

  • Must be a self starter and have the ability to multi task 

  • Friendly, outgoing personality

  • Must be able to work at a fast pace

Responsibilities:

Facility Maintenance

  • Ensure that all facilities, buildings and assets that are used by the company are maintained and repaired in a proper and cost-effective manner. 

  • Makes recommendations on maintenance and improvements. 

  • Prioritizes and sets goals based on importance of project that needs attention.

Equipment Maintenance

  • Performs maintenance on all tools and machinery at the facility. Inspects and documents the maintenance performed on equipment. 

  • Recommends orders and stocks miscellaneous spare parts for equipment in order to keep equipment running at all times. 

Safety

  • Adheres to safety requirements when operating tools and equipment. 

  • Ensures safety functions on equipment are operating properly. 

  • Handles material in a safe and appropriate manner. 

  • Reports any defects or safety issues immediately.
